Netanyahu Says Gaza-Egypt Crossing to Remain Closed Until Hamas Returns All Deceased Hostages

Netanyahu vows to keep Gaza-Egypt crossing closed until Hamas returns all deceased hostages. Rafah Crossing to remain shut indefinitely.

Jerusalem, 19 october, 2025 (TPS-IL) — Prime Minister Netanyahu has indicated that the Rafah Crossing – the sole crossing between Gaza and Egypt – will not be opened until further notice. Its opening will be considered depending on how Hamas fulfills its part in returning the remains of deceased hostages and implementing the agreed-upon outline.
